Taxonomic Classification

Rank Cambodian Striped Squirrel Pearl stingray
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um same Chordata (Chordates)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Elasmobranchii
Order Rodentia (Rodents) Myliobatiformes (Myliobatiformes)
Family Sciuridae (Squirrels) Dasyatidae
Genus Tamiops Fontitrygon
Species Tamiops rodolphii Fontitrygon margaritella

Evolutionary Relationship

Cambodian Striped Squirrel and Pearl stingray share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
